Я пытаюсь избежать цикла for с DateTimeIndex. У меня есть функция get_latest, которая ищет самое последнее значение индекса заработной платы. Когда я просматриваю даты дней зарплаты, поиск работает нормально. Когда я пытаюсь векторизовать операцию, мне сообщается TypeError: объект 'numpy.ndarray' не может быть вызван. Я пробовал все способы dt, date, to_pydatetime и т. д., но безрезультатно.
# %%
import pandas as pd
import datetime
# %%
def get_latest(date, series):
return series.loc[max([x for x in series.index if x
Подробнее здесь: https://stackoverflow.com/questions/793 ... etimeindex
Как векторизовать Pandas DateTimeIndex ⇐ Python
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
-
Как правильно построить серию Pandas, имеющую нулевые значения и DateTimeIndex?
Anonymous » » в форуме Python - 0 Ответы
- 17 Просмотры
-
Последнее сообщение Anonymous
-
-
-
`pd.DateTimeIndex` рекомендуется использовать в библиотеке backtesting.py.
Anonymous » » в форуме Python - 0 Ответы
- 11 Просмотры
-
Последнее сообщение Anonymous
-